VDR startet nach versuch ein Startlogo einzufügen nicht mehr

  • Habe soeben meinen VDR mehr oder weniger abgeschossen. Eigentlich wollte ich nur wie HIER beschrieben ein Start- und Stoplogo einfügen. Das ganze hat soweit auch funktioniert. Nur habe ich seither das Problem das der VDR nicht mehr startet. Meine Syslog hört mit diesen Zeilen auf:


    Normal sollte hier doch dann der VDR gestartet werden und unter anderem zum User VDR wechseln.
    Wenn ich nun versuche den VDR per Hand mit /etc/init.d/vdr start zu starten, passiert weiter auch nichts. Kann es sein das irgendwo ein Eintrag fehlt oder ähnliches?


    System: c´t VDR 6

    Mein VDR:
    Hardware: MSI MS 6318 Rev.1, Seagate 7200.9 250GB, 378MB SD 133 Infineon RAM, Hauppauge DVB-S 1.5, Gehäuse Eigenbau, 240x128 gLCD mit Toshiba T6963c Chipsatz
    Software: c´t VDR 4.5 + Kernel 2.4.31 -ct-1

  • Als Aussage in der Console bekomme ich die normale Antwort:
    Starting Linux Video Disk Recorder...
    Searching for Plugins...


    Fehlermeldung bekomme ich keine und auch keinen Eintrag im Syslog.


    Allerdings startet der VDR auch nicht. Es ist eigentlich so als hätte ich den Befehl garnicht eingegeben.

    Mein VDR:
    Hardware: MSI MS 6318 Rev.1, Seagate 7200.9 250GB, 378MB SD 133 Infineon RAM, Hauppauge DVB-S 1.5, Gehäuse Eigenbau, 240x128 gLCD mit Toshiba T6963c Chipsatz
    Software: c´t VDR 4.5 + Kernel 2.4.31 -ct-1

    Einmal editiert, zuletzt von foerscht ()

  • Hab jetzt nochmal getestet, in meiner Syslog taucht jetzt folgendes auf:

    Code
    Jun 19 15:09:33 VDR-Hardy kernel: ppdev0: claim the port first
    Jun 19 15:09:33 VDR-Hardy kernel: ppdev0: negotiated back to compatibility mode because user-space forgot
    Jun 19 15:09:33 VDR-Hardy kernel: ppdev0: unregistered pardevice

    Es scheint also am Display bzw an der config zu liegen. Ich nutze das Display aus diesem Tread: http://vdr-portal.de/board/thread.php?threadid=48139&hilight=unregistered+pardevice
    Meine graphlcd.conf:

    Das Display funktioniert mit dem Startlogo. Bevor ich das Problem hatte, funktionierte es auch im VDR Betrieb!
    Habt ihr da einen Tip für mich?

    Mein VDR:
    Hardware: MSI MS 6318 Rev.1, Seagate 7200.9 250GB, 378MB SD 133 Infineon RAM, Hauppauge DVB-S 1.5, Gehäuse Eigenbau, 240x128 gLCD mit Toshiba T6963c Chipsatz
    Software: c´t VDR 4.5 + Kernel 2.4.31 -ct-1

  • Ist bei mir zwar lange her, dass ich die Start/Stop Animationen eingebaut habe. Allerdings erinnere ich mich daran, dass ich dabei auch Probleme hatte, wenn ich auch nicht mehr sagen kann, was es genau war.


    Fakt ist, dass ich bei mir die Start/Stop Animationen mit einem zusätzlichen Eintrag in der graphlcd.conf realisiert habe. Dabei wird direkt auf die LPT-Schnittstelle zugegriffen, und nicht der Umweg über das parport-Device genommen. Ist hier kein Problem, da das Scipt ohnehin mit vollen Rechten läuft.


    Hier meine Configs, vielleicht hilft es dir..
    .
    zusätzlicher Eintrag in /etc/graphlcd.conf

    Code
    [t6963c]
    ....
    #zusaetzlicher Eintrag fuer Start/Stop splash
    [t6963cStart]
    # t6963c driver
    #  This is a driver module for the Toshiba T6963C LCD controller.
    #  Default size: 240 x 128
    Driver=t6963c
    Port=0x378


    /etc/init.d/lcdsplash


    Dann noch einen Symlink zu lcdspalsh zum Start/stop in den entsprechenden /etc/rc??? Verzeichnissen anlegen, aber das wirst du ja in ähnlicher Form bereits haben.

    VDR1: AMD Duron-1300, 512mb RAM, Nexus-S rev2.1, Airstar 2, Debian Lenny, kernel: 2.6.28-etobi.3, VDR 1.6.0-17 experimental/extensions von Tobi
    VDR2: Athlon XP-M-2600+, 512mb RAM, TT Prem 1.3 DVB-S, Skystar2, Airstar 2, Debian Lenny, kernel: 2.6.28-etobi.3, VDR 1.6.0-17 experimental/extensions von Tobi
    Extern: Activy300, Gen2VDR V2

  • Danke für deine Hilfe!
    Leider kann ich damit nichts anfangen. Meine Startanimation funktioniert ja, nur mein VDR startet danach nicht. Jetzt habe ich diese Werte in der Config geändert:

    Code
    #Port=0x378
    Device=/dev/parport0

    in:

    Code
    Port=0x378
    #Device=/dev/parport0

    Damit sind nun die Zeilen

    Code
    Jun 19 15:09:33 VDR-Hardy kernel: ppdev0: claim the port first
    Jun 19 15:09:33 VDR-Hardy kernel: ppdev0: negotiated back to compatibility mode because user-space forgot
    Jun 19 15:09:33 VDR-Hardy kernel: ppdev0: unregistered pardevice

    im Syslog verschwunden aber mein VDR startet noch immer nicht.


    Habe ich evt einen wichtigen Eintrag in einer Datei gelöscht? So das der VDR nicht mehr gestartet wird?
    So langsam gehen mir die Ideen aus...

    Mein VDR:
    Hardware: MSI MS 6318 Rev.1, Seagate 7200.9 250GB, 378MB SD 133 Infineon RAM, Hauppauge DVB-S 1.5, Gehäuse Eigenbau, 240x128 gLCD mit Toshiba T6963c Chipsatz
    Software: c´t VDR 4.5 + Kernel 2.4.31 -ct-1

  • Funktioniert VDR, wenn du das Startlogo nicht ausgibst?

    VDR1: AMD Duron-1300, 512mb RAM, Nexus-S rev2.1, Airstar 2, Debian Lenny, kernel: 2.6.28-etobi.3, VDR 1.6.0-17 experimental/extensions von Tobi
    VDR2: Athlon XP-M-2600+, 512mb RAM, TT Prem 1.3 DVB-S, Skystar2, Airstar 2, Debian Lenny, kernel: 2.6.28-etobi.3, VDR 1.6.0-17 experimental/extensions von Tobi
    Extern: Activy300, Gen2VDR V2

  • Hallo da will ich mich doch mahl in die Ratestunde einschalten.


    Da ja immer noch eine kein genauer Grund für das fehlschlagen des VDR Starts gefunden ist, würde ich vorschlagen den VDR manuell auf der Konsole zu Starten und gegebenenfalls erst einmal ohne Plugins. Vielleicht lässt es sich dann genauer eingrenzen. Auch wenn auch ich glaube das es am Graphlcd liegt.

  • Zitat

    Original von geeg07
    Funktioniert VDR, wenn du das Startlogo nicht ausgibst?


    Nein, leider nicht. Das war das erste was ich getestet habe.


    Werde morgen (Heute ist es zu spät, muss um 5 wieder raus...) mal testen ob der VDR ohne graphlcd läuft. Glaub es aber fast nicht, da es vorher ja auch mit gegangen ist und die config nicht geändert worden ist. Aber ich werds sehen.


    Wenn jemand noch Ideen hat, als her damit!

    Mein VDR:
    Hardware: MSI MS 6318 Rev.1, Seagate 7200.9 250GB, 378MB SD 133 Infineon RAM, Hauppauge DVB-S 1.5, Gehäuse Eigenbau, 240x128 gLCD mit Toshiba T6963c Chipsatz
    Software: c´t VDR 4.5 + Kernel 2.4.31 -ct-1

  • Das kann ich mir fast nicht vorstellen, wenn du sonst keine Änderungen vorgenommen hast, sollte eigentlich alles wieder funktionieren, wenn du die Bootlogo-Ausgabe wieder entfernst.


    Was mir noch aufgefallen ist: wenn dein VDR nicht als root läuft, dann muss für das graphlcd-plugin das parport-device verwendet werden, das war der Grund für meinen zusätzlichen Eintrag in der graphlcd.conf.


    Warum du keine Meldungen in den Logs zum VDR-Start erhältst, verstehe ich allerdings nicht.

    VDR1: AMD Duron-1300, 512mb RAM, Nexus-S rev2.1, Airstar 2, Debian Lenny, kernel: 2.6.28-etobi.3, VDR 1.6.0-17 experimental/extensions von Tobi
    VDR2: Athlon XP-M-2600+, 512mb RAM, TT Prem 1.3 DVB-S, Skystar2, Airstar 2, Debian Lenny, kernel: 2.6.28-etobi.3, VDR 1.6.0-17 experimental/extensions von Tobi
    Extern: Activy300, Gen2VDR V2

  • Ich hab jetzt also mal das graphlcd plugin deinstalliert und den VDR neu gebootet - Alles wie gehabt, der VDR startet nicht und ich hab auch keine Einträge im log...
    Was mich aber wundert, die Startanimation funktioniert noch immer oder hat nichts mit dem graphlcd plugin zu tun? Configs habe ich nicht deinstalliert.

    Mein VDR:
    Hardware: MSI MS 6318 Rev.1, Seagate 7200.9 250GB, 378MB SD 133 Infineon RAM, Hauppauge DVB-S 1.5, Gehäuse Eigenbau, 240x128 gLCD mit Toshiba T6963c Chipsatz
    Software: c´t VDR 4.5 + Kernel 2.4.31 -ct-1

  • Da mir genauso wie allen anderen hier die Ideen ausgehen woran es liegen könnte, werde ich den VDR jetzt wohl neu installieren und die paar sachen neu konfigurieren. Denke das ist die beste und einfachste Lösung, leider!

    Mein VDR:
    Hardware: MSI MS 6318 Rev.1, Seagate 7200.9 250GB, 378MB SD 133 Infineon RAM, Hauppauge DVB-S 1.5, Gehäuse Eigenbau, 240x128 gLCD mit Toshiba T6963c Chipsatz
    Software: c´t VDR 4.5 + Kernel 2.4.31 -ct-1

Jetzt mitmachen!

Sie haben noch kein Benutzerkonto auf unserer Seite? Registrieren Sie sich kostenlos und nehmen Sie an unserer Community teil!